Does your air purifier have a programming panel? If not – are you ready to be nervous at work trying to remember whether you switched off the machine? The same applies to remote controls as well: are you ready to run around the house when changing the mode of the purifier?

Do you know the difference between the ozone generators and air cleaners/purifiers? Ozone generators do not exactly clean you air, they are producing ozone. Ozone differs from oxygen we breathe by only one molecule – not much, but enough for severe distinguishing it from the ‘fresh air’ notion. It means that allergy or asthma suffering people will not feel good in surrounding where the ozone producing is involved, even healthy people will be more sensitive to throat irritation and respiratory infections. An absolutely different technology is used in air purifiers as they produce the recirculation of the indoor air through the filters. As you may see, the real purification of air we have in the second variant. Bring your attention to this.

Does the system of an air purifier reminds you about the filter replacement or you need to check it regularly by yourself?

What filters do you need? Practice shows the more – the better. There are pre-filter (retains larger particles), HEPA® filter or carbon one (for micro-particles), Humidifier filter, Ionizer Add-on etc.

Does you air purifier allows you to install additional filters/add-ons? If yes, it may help you to renew your home air purifier with additional features in future.

What area is to be purified? Remember, air purifier may be portable or integrated into your home HSVA. If it is portable, look at the area it covers in the technical description.
